One thing I saw in all that mess was "buffer underrun." have you tried turning your CD write speed down a little (I'm assuming you are using MAX speed)? Say if you have a 48x try writing with it set to 32x, and if that is successful, then work your way up to find the fastest speed that doesn't give errors.

yes, turning on both DMA and buffer underrun protection would help.

if your burner doesn't come with buffer underrun protection, i recommend you:

1. burn at lower speeds (2x, 4x)
2. defrag your harddrive beforehand
3. have at least 800 MB free space on your HD
4. close all your other programs

DMA is the big issue it seems. Your burner doesn't have DMA on and your dvd drive does.

Go into device manager and select IDE controllers. Then look at the primary and secondary controllers and make sure everything says "dma if available", I have the feeling your burner is runnng PIO ONLY mode.

Don't waste money buying another burner.
